Episode 98 - 10 Things To Consider When Coaching Adolescent Football Players

Send us a textEpisode 98, Brought to you in association with our friends at Soccer Coach Weekly (@SoccerCoachWeek) Episode 98 – 10 Things To Consider When Coaching Adolescent Football PlayersIn this episode Scott reflects back on his experience of coaching the U13 and U14 boys’ team for the past two seasons. Scott talks about the differences between adolescence and puberty and how on reflection he wasn’t as informed as he could and should have been to fully understand and support the players.Scott then lists the 10 things that coaches may want to consider if they are coaching players in the adolescent phase of their lives.1)      Individual differences2)      Physical changes3)      Psychological and emotional well-being 4)      Motor skills development5)      Cognitive development6)      Social dynamics7)      Training load management8)      Communication and empathy9)      Nutrition and hydration10)   Personal hygienePlease do leave a review, like and share the episode!The Soccer Coaching Podcast, Twitter - @SoccerCoachCastThe Soccer Coaching Podcast, Email - thesoccercoachingpodcast@gmail.comThis episode was brought to you in association with our friends at Soccer Coach Weekly.Established since 2006, Soccer Coach Weekly is a leading source of inspiration and advice for all grassroots coaches.
